About The Position

Workstream is seeking an experienced in-house legal counsel to support its rapid growth across contracts, compliance, product counsel, governance, and employment matters. This role will handle day-to-day legal needs while partnering with external counsel on specialized matters. The Legal Counsel will act as a trusted business partner across Sales, Product, Partnerships, Finance, and People Ops, balancing legal rigor with startup speed and business judgment. As Workstream integrates AI/ML capabilities, this role will be crucial in ensuring compliance and managing emerging legal risks.

Requirements

  • Licensed to practice in at least one US jurisdiction (CA bar preferred).
  • 10+ years of legal experience.
  • 5-7+ years in-house at a SaaS or tech company.
  • Expertise in commercial contract negotiation (SaaS, MSAs, DPAs, vendor agreements).
  • Strong knowledge of privacy compliance (GDPR, CCPA, CPRA) and ability to advise on privacy-by-design principles.
  • Experience advising product and engineering teams on legal/compliance implications of product features.
  • Familiarity with employment law, IP basics, and board governance.
  • Excellent communication skills; ability to translate legal concepts for business and product stakeholders.
  • Comfort with ambiguity and fast-paced environments.
  • Proficiency with contract management tools (DocuSign, Ironclad) and document platforms.

Nice To Haves

  • Familiarity with AI/ML legal risks and governance.
  • M&A or financing experience.

Responsibilities

  • Draft, review, and negotiate customer MSAs, DPAs, amendments, and vendor agreements.
  • Identify material risks and maintain contract playbooks and templates.
  • Advise on privacy compliance (GDPR, CCPA, CPRA) and ensure Privacy Policy and ToS stay current with product and regulatory changes.
  • Partner with Product and Engineering teams to advise on legal implications of new features, AI/ML capabilities, data handling practices, and user consent requirements.
  • Provide early-stage legal guardrails for product development.
  • Manage IP matters including trademark registrations and licensing compliance.
  • Support Board governance including meeting materials and corporate governance policies.
  • Review employment agreements, advise on hiring/termination/wage-and-hour compliance, and support HR on employment relations issues.
  • Partner cross-functionally with Sales, Product, Partnerships, Finance, and People Ops to provide timely legal guidance.
  • Coordinate with external counsel on complex matters.
